Soybeans futures end mixed
By Pro Farmer - Fri 15 Mar 2013 15:01:30 CT
Related Keywords: Agriculture
Soybean futures ended 5 1/4 to 9 1/2 cents lower through the August contract, September soybeans closed steady and new-crop contracts were 1 1/4 to 6 higher today. For the week, soybean futures posted losses, with old-crop contracts leading the decline amid bull spread unwinding. Price action this week signals a short-term top is in place for old-crop futures and that traders feel the U.S. export season is quickly coming to an end.
